AI语音对话在智能音箱中的技术实现原理
随着科技的不断发展,人工智能技术已经深入到我们生活的方方面面。智能音箱作为智能家居的代表之一,已经成为了许多家庭必备的智能设备。而AI语音对话作为智能音箱的核心功能,其技术实现原理也成为了人们关注的焦点。本文将围绕AI语音对话在智能音箱中的技术实现原理展开,讲述一个关于AI语音对话的故事。
故事的主人公是一位名叫李明的年轻人,他是一名科技爱好者。一天,李明在逛商场时,被一款新型的智能音箱吸引住了。这款智能音箱名叫“小爱”,拥有强大的AI语音对话功能。李明对这款音箱产生了浓厚的兴趣,于是决定深入了解其背后的技术原理。
首先,我们需要了解智能音箱的工作流程。当用户对着智能音箱说话时,声音信号会通过麦克风采集,然后经过信号处理模块进行初步处理。接下来,我们将从以下几个方面来讲述AI语音对话在智能音箱中的技术实现原理。
一、语音识别
语音识别是AI语音对话技术的第一步,它将用户的声音信号转换为文本信息。在智能音箱中,语音识别主要依靠深度学习技术实现。以下是语音识别的基本流程:
麦克风采集:智能音箱的麦克风将用户的声音信号转换为电信号。
预处理:对采集到的电信号进行降噪、去混响等处理,提高语音质量。
特征提取:将预处理后的语音信号转换为特征向量,如梅尔频率倒谱系数(MFCC)等。
模型训练:利用大量标注好的语音数据,训练深度学习模型,如卷积神经网络(CNN)、循环神经网络(RNN)等。
识别:将实时采集到的语音信号输入训练好的模型,得到对应的文本信息。
二、自然语言处理
语音识别得到的文本信息需要经过自然语言处理(NLP)技术进行进一步处理,以理解用户的需求。以下是自然语言处理的基本流程:
分词:将文本信息分割成词语,便于后续处理。
词性标注:对每个词语进行词性标注,如名词、动词、形容词等。
依存句法分析:分析词语之间的依存关系,理解句子的结构。
意图识别:根据句子的结构、语义等信息,判断用户的需求。
实体识别:识别句子中的实体,如人名、地名、组织机构等。
三、语义理解
语义理解是AI语音对话技术的核心,它将用户的需求转化为智能音箱可以执行的操作。以下是语义理解的基本流程:
语义解析:根据意图识别和实体识别的结果,将文本信息转化为语义表示。
语义匹配:将语义表示与智能音箱内置的知识库进行匹配,找到对应的操作。
语义生成:根据匹配结果,生成相应的操作指令。
四、语音合成
当智能音箱完成用户需求后,需要将操作结果以语音的形式反馈给用户。语音合成技术将文本信息转换为语音信号,以下是语音合成的基本流程:
文本预处理:对操作结果进行文本预处理,如去除标点符号、格式化等。
语音合成模型:利用深度学习技术,如循环神经网络(RNN)、长短时记忆网络(LSTM)等,将文本信息转换为语音信号。
语音合成:将生成的语音信号通过扬声器播放,完成语音合成。
故事中的李明通过深入了解智能音箱的AI语音对话技术,对这款产品产生了浓厚的兴趣。他开始关注智能音箱的发展动态,并尝试自己动手制作一款简易的智能音箱。在制作过程中,李明不断学习语音识别、自然语言处理、语义理解等知识,逐渐掌握了AI语音对话技术的核心原理。
经过一段时间的努力,李明成功制作出了一款简易的智能音箱,并实现了基本的AI语音对话功能。他将这款音箱命名为“小智”,寓意着智慧与便捷。李明的“小智”在朋友圈中引起了广泛关注,许多朋友纷纷向他请教制作方法。
随着技术的不断进步,AI语音对话在智能音箱中的应用越来越广泛。从最初的简单查询天气、播放音乐,到如今的智能家居控制、生活助手等功能,AI语音对话技术已经成为了智能音箱的核心竞争力。相信在不久的将来,AI语音对话技术将在更多领域得到应用,为我们的生活带来更多便利。
总之,AI语音对话在智能音箱中的技术实现原理是一个复杂而有趣的过程。从语音识别到自然语言处理,再到语义理解和语音合成,每一个环节都离不开深度学习、神经网络等先进技术的支持。通过深入了解这些技术原理,我们可以更好地理解智能音箱的工作原理,并为未来的创新提供更多思路。正如故事中的李明一样,只要我们勇于探索、不断学习,就能在科技的世界中找到属于自己的舞台。
猜你喜欢:聊天机器人开发